This recent series of paintings represent my long-held belief that both the art of photography and painting are not competitive but are a singular expression of an inspired visual dialogue with the world. A brief moment of insight acquires an emotional resonance when stretched over the long process of translation into brushwork, color and design.

These particular painted images derive from early photographs taken in the late 60’s and 70’s.
They take on new meaning and possibilities as monochromatic celebrations of time
and space and the human condition.
